Book Presentation:
Explore the iconic concept designs, beautiful matte paintings, and stunning artwork from artist Dylan Cole, concept artist for Avatar, Avatar: The Way of Water, Tron: Legacy, Maleficent, and more!
From Avatar: The Way of Water to Pirates of the Caribbean: At World’s End, Dylan Cole has created spectacular concept art and matte paintings for some of Disney’s most popular films. Explore exquisite concept art for the Mad Hatter’s tea party and the Red Queen’s castle from Alice in Wonderland, or step into the lush painted landscapes of Aurora’s forest cottage from Maleficent. Featuring in-depth insights into the creation of each artwork and the thoughts behind the creative process, Creating Worlds: The Disney and 20th Century Studios Cinematic Art of Dylan Cole is a must-read for film fans and artists alike.
STUNNING ARTWORK: Flip through incredible full-color artwork—including concept sketches, poster designs and matte paintings—from each of your favorite films
EXCLUSIVE PIECES: Discover never-before-seen artwork from key films, including Avatar, Alita: Battle Angel, Oz the Great and Powerful, and more
GO BEHIND THE CREATIVE PROCESS: Dive into Cole’s creative process as he describes how he brings his ideas to live and gives unique insight into the stories behind each piece
About the Author:
Dylan Cole is the Academy Award nominated Co-Production Designer of Avatar: The Way of Water. He oversees design for the entire Avatar franchise, specifically for the moon of Pandora, including all its environments, creatures, characters, and cultures. A veteran of the industry for over 20 years, he has contributed art to over 60 films. Notable credits includeSenior Matte Painter on LOTR: Return of the King, Concept Art Director on Avatar, and Production Designer for Maleficent.
